Does LS Engine need VSS and ECT (Engine coolant temp) to run?
Also, im running brand new gauge cluster and no OEM gauges. Does the ECU need oil/water temp/ pressure info for anything if i were to control fan manually for some reason
Last edited by BNR34RB26DETT; Jun 22, 2016 at 08:30 PM.
Removing the VSS MAY cause problems coming to a stop. Different people have had different results with that one.
Oil temperature and oil pressure are not needed at all.
I have been running without a VSS for 10+ years.. no problem, even with my AC running. But this is with a manual trans.. if you had a Auto trans, you would have drivability issues as stated above.
I run a standalone SPAL Duel Fan Controller, so it isn't controlled by the ECM and ECT.
I use a Line Lock switch on my shifter to control my reverse lock out. I hold it down while going into reverse.
As suggested, just run all of the sensors as needed (O2, ECT, etc..). Oil pressure is one that the ECM doesn't need, the BCM would uses it for the dash gauges.
BC






